नायिका

Hindi

Etymology

Borrowed from Sanskrit नायिका (nāyikā), feminine form of नायक (nāyaka).

Pronunciation

  • (Delhi) IPA(key): /nɑː.jɪ.kɑː/, [näː.jɪ.käː]

Noun

नायिका • (nāyikāf

  1. heroine, main actress
    Synonym: हीरोइन (hīroin)
    इस फ़िल्म की नायिका नाटक करने में इतनी अच्छी नहीं है।
    is film kī nāyikā nāṭak karne mẽ itnī acchī nahī̃ hai.
    The heroine in this film is not that good at acting.

Marathi

Etymology

Borrowed from Sanskrit नायिका (nāyikā). First attested as Old Marathi 𑘡𑘰𑘧𑘎𑘰 (nāyakā).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/na.ji.ka/
  • Rhymes: -a
  • Hyphenation: ना‧यि‧का

Noun

नायिका • (nāyikāf (masculine नायक)

  1. heroine (of a story, movie, play etc.)
    Antonym: खलनायिका (khalnāyikā)
